Benefits and Drawbacks of Online News Sources

With the rise of online news sources, it has become easier for people to stay updated on the latest news, including sports news, live matches, and world news. However, with the numerous benefits come some drawbacks that are worth considering.

One of the significant benefits of online news sources is the convenience they offer. With just a few clicks, you can access news from around the world, including sports news, live matches, and world news. This convenience is particularly useful for those who are always on-the-go or have limited time to stay updated on current events.

Another benefit of online news sources is the variety of news they offer. You can access news from multiple sources, including local, national, and international news outlets. This variety ensures that you get a well-rounded view of the news, rather than relying on a single source.

Online news sources also offer real-time updates, which is particularly useful for those who want to stay updated on breaking news, such as live matches or world news. This allows you to stay informed and up-to-date on the latest developments, without having to wait for the next day’s newspaper.

Drawbacks of Online News Sources

Despite the benefits, online news sources also have some drawbacks. One of the main concerns is the lack of fact-checking and verification. With the ease of publishing online, some news sources may not always verify the accuracy of the information they publish, which can lead to the spread of misinformation.

Another drawback is the abundance of biased and sensationalized news. With the rise of online news sources, some outlets may prioritize sensationalism over accuracy, which can lead to a distorted view of the news.

Finally, online news sources can also be overwhelming, with the sheer volume of information available. This can make it difficult to sift through the noise and find the most important and relevant news.

In conclusion, while online news sources offer many benefits, including convenience, variety, and real-time updates, they also have some drawbacks, including the lack of fact-checking, biased and sensationalized news, and the overwhelming amount of information available. It is essential to be critical of the news sources you use and to verify the accuracy of the information you consume.

How to Evaluate Online News Sources

Evaluating online news sources is crucial in today’s digital age, where misinformation and disinformation can spread rapidly. With the abundance of news sources available online, it’s essential to know how to separate fact from fiction. Here’s a step-by-step guide on how to evaluate online news sources:

Step 1: Verify the Source

  • Check the website’s domain name and URL. Legitimate news sources usually have a .com or .org domain name.
  • Look for the website’s About page or contact information to verify its credibility.

Step 2: Check the Date and Time

  • Make sure the news article is up-to-date and not outdated.
  • Check the publication date and time to ensure it’s recent and not old news.

Step 3: Check the Author’s Credentials

  • Check the author’s bio and credentials to ensure they have expertise in the topic.
  • Look for any biases or conflicts of interest that may affect the article’s accuracy.

Step 4: Check for Fact-Checking

  • Look for fact-checking organizations or independent fact-checkers that verify the article’s accuracy.
  • Check for any corrections or updates made to the article.

Step 5: Check for Similar Sources

  • Search for similar news articles from other reputable sources to verify the accuracy of the original article.
  • Compare the different sources’ reporting to identify any discrepancies or biases.

Step 6: Be Cautious of Sensational Headlines

  • Be wary of sensational headlines that may be exaggerated or misleading.
  • Read the article carefully to ensure it’s not just a clickbait.

Step 7: Use Online Tools and Resources

  • Use online tools like Snopes, FactCheck.org, or PolitiFact to verify the accuracy of news articles.
  • Use reputable fact-checking websites to verify the accuracy of news sources.
